About this vibe coding template

A two-column brand section for AI research and discovery platforms. The layout is a 2:3 column split on a saturated royal blue background. The left column stacks four elements: a large star or asterisk symbol as a visual mark, a two-line bold brand name in white at 28px, a grey subtitle in smaller text, and a ghost pill button with a right-arrow icon. The right column is filled by a JavaScript-generated wordcloud of repeating NEW labels in cyan (#22d3ee), each span positioned inline with varying opacity values cycling through nine levels from 15% to 100%. The varying opacity creates the visual impression of layered data density — a large amount of information being processed or surfaced in real time. The wordcloud is masked at the bottom with a gradient fade to transparent. This layout directly replicates the design pattern used by AI research and competitive intelligence products that want to communicate data richness visually without showing actual data.

Common questions about this template

How do I change the wordcloud text?

Ask your vibe coding tool to update the textContent value in the JavaScript loop from NEW to any word or short phrase relevant to your product. For a research tool this might be INSIGHT, SIGNAL, or DATA. For an AI tool it might be the name of a feature or the type of content your AI processes.

How do I change the brand name and star symbol?

Ask Bolt, Claude Code, Replit, or Lovable to update the text inside the brand div and change the Unicode character in the star div. The star uses a decorative asterisk character. Replace it with any Unicode symbol, or ask the AI to place a small SVG icon there instead.

How do I adjust the wordcloud density and colors?

Ask your vibe coding tool to change the loop count (140) to increase or decrease density, update the gap value between spans to spread or tighten the grid, and modify the color in the word CSS rule to change the wordcloud color from cyan to your brand color.
